Springsteen playing Saturday Obama rally on the Parkway

POSTED: Tuesday, September 30, 2008, 5:03 PM
Filed Under: Breaking News

Bruce Springsteen will perform at a Saturday afternoon rally to benefit Sen. Barack Obama on Benjamin Franklin Parkway, the Obama campaign has just announced. The Boss will play between 20th and 22nd streets. Gates open at 2 p.m. with the rally to begin at 3:30. Preferred tickets go to Obama campaign volunteers who visit one of his local campaign offices starting at 10 a.m. tomorrow.
